#101 CRAFT STUDIOS - FREE CRAFT PROJECT

Spin Art Glass Dinner Plates
Design & Instructions by Pattie Donham, Host of Craft Studios

These Spin Art Glass Dinner Plates will take you back to those days at the county fair when you spun and painted psychedelic designs. 

Supplies:
Clear Glass Plates
Pebeo® Glass Paints: 
Vitrea™ 160 – Grenadine, Indian Red, Ink Black, Amaranthine
Lazy Susan (rotating tray)
A Box, larger than the lazy susan
Glue Dots
Waxed Paper
Tape
Knife
Oven & Oven Mitts


Steps:
1. Cover the lazy susan with waxed paper, taping in place. Place the lazy susan inside the box.
2. Clean the glass plate thoroughly.
3. Place 3 or 4 glue dots on the top edge of the glass plate.
4. Place the plate face down on the lazy susan, with the glue dots holding it in place. 
5. Spin the lazy susan and pour a stream of paint from the center of the plate to the edge. Stop the lazy susan from spinning. Repeat for additional colors.
6. Pull the glass plate from the lazy susan and let dry 24 hours. Remove the glue dots if they are remaining on the plate. Scrap off any excess paint from the edges of the plate with a knife.
7. Place in a 325º oven for 40 minutes. Will withstand dishwasher after baking.
